可视化设计在低代码开发中的应用

2024-08-06  I  标签:微信公众号开发

可视化设计在低代码开发中的应用

探讨了低代码开发领域中两种主要的可视化设计方案——流程图与树形结构的应用场景及其优势。

在低代码开发领域中, 可视化设计已经成为提升开发效率的关键手段之一。其中, “图形”和“树”这两种设计方式尤为突出。
图:以流程图的形式描述业务逻辑的历史可以追溯到软件行业的诞生之初。时至今日, 大量的需求者仍然倾向于使用如Microsoft Visio这样的工具绘制出业务流程图, 并将其作为核心需求文档提交给开发团队。因此, 提供一种类似于绘制流程图的设计体验, 已成为许多低代码平台的首选方案。特别是在节点数量较少, 判断逻辑和循环规则相对简单的情况下, 这种开发体验不仅让结果更加直观, 而且非常适合于开发人员与需求方之间的讨论与确认。
树:树作为一种基本的数据结构, 在计算机科学中占据着重要地位, 同样也是集成开发环境中高级语言的基本表示形式。每行可执行语句被视为一个叶节点, 而像if这样的复合语句则构成了父节点。编程时, 开发者通过换行、缩进或者大括号等语法符号来表达这种层级关系。执行时, 程序将按照开发者的意图, 从根节点开始, 一步步执行每一个节点的指令。这种方法已经在大部分高级编程语言中被广泛采用, 其适用性得到了充分验证。因此, 致力于扩展可视化覆盖范围, 最终实现低代码开发的平台, 通常会采用树形结构来构建业务逻辑的设计体验。
立即体验这种创新的开发方式, 您将发现它不仅能够简化开发流程, 更能显著提高工作效率。

``` Note: The content has been crafted to ensure a low repetition rate while maintaining semantic coherence and adhering to the specified HTML structure using `

` for the title and `

` tags for the keywords, description, and content.

继续阅读本文相关话题
微信公众号开发